Personal track safety pts is a system of safer working practices employed within the united kingdom designed to ensure the safety of railway workers who have to work on or near the line the principal hazards include collisions between a rail vehicle and a track worker, electrocution from traction power sources third rail, fourth rail, ohle and trips and falls.
